What are the responsibilities and job description for the Radiology Department Supervisor position at Mountain Lakes Medical Center?
JOB SUMMARY:
Responsible for the internal and external supervision of the Department of Radiology and all imaging services; which includes Ultrasound Imaging (US), Stress Test (TST), CT examinations, X-Ray examinations, Mammography, MRI and the staff of these departments.
Works with the Director of Ancillary Services to direct, plan, organize, and control radiology functions to:
- Assure that all imaging standards are consistent with the requirements of their specific regulatory bodies.
- Assure that resources are available to provide patient care in a cost-effective manner.
- Enhance cooperative working relationships in all imaging services and between departments.
- Enhance professional growth.
- Interpret hospital and radiology services policies to others.

EDUCATION/TRAINING
Appropriate Licensing and Certification required in imaging field of expertise preferred.
Prior experience with Ultrasound
A Graduate of an accredited or recognized school of imaging preferred.
High School Diploma or GED required.
Current BLS certification required.
MINIMUM WORK EXPERIENCE
At least five (5) years imaging experience in a health related field.
Demonstrated clinical competence in imaging services.
Administrative and leadership experience required.

PHYSICAL WORKING CONDITIONS:
- Work standing on their feet 80% of the time.
- Lift more then 50 pounds routinely.
- They also push and pull and bend and stoop routinely.
